Northwestern Academy of Homeopathy Professional Training Program in Classical Homeopathy. Our curriculum provides a strong academic base, followed by a unique clinical training program.

NAH is ACHENA-accredited to meet eligibility for certification. ACCREDITED
Our part-time program is ACHENA accredited, meeting the highest standards for homeopathic education. Our inclusive faculty span 50 years of homeopathic practice and teaching. They guide our passionate students who arrive from diverse times of life, cultures and careers on an in-depth, personal and professional training jour

ney toward the art of practicing homeopathy. IN-DEPTH
Our four-year didactic-clinical program is based on classical homeopathic philosophy and materia medica. We believe in a balanced approach, giving students a solid, formal foundation from which to understand and apply ever-evolving homeopathic principles and methods. HANDS-ON
Following our two-year didactic portion, our two-year clinical training program is unique in the field. Our graduates gain essential hands-on practice via clinical experience and supervision, finishing with a mentorship matched to support them as they launch their practice. FLEXIBLE, HYBRID LEARNING
Students and faculty join our academy sessions online or in-person from around the globe. Our class sessions are predominantly live (synchronous) in Central Standard Time and occur once a month for a three-day period. With our tried-and-true part-time, four-year schedule, most students maintain their other occupations while finishing the program, ready to launch into practice. HEALING JOURNEY
As healing practitioners, we know that our own health and healing is as important as that of our clients. Our program includes introspective components that help our students develop healing practices that grow along with them. Our alumni remark that our program fosters deep connections among classmates and community that support them for a lifetime. COMMUNITY
NAH's subsidiary, Minnesota Remedies, Inc. dispenses homeopathic preparations to homeopaths around North America. NAH and alumni maintain partnerships with local, national and international holistic organizations in support of our graduates, homeopathy, and professional collaboration. CREDENTIALS
By graduation, our alumni are prepared to sit for the Council for Homeopathic Certification exam (CCH credential), meeting the highest standards for homeopathic preparation and practice in North America.
